Requirements

  • Have a Bachelor's Degree in Early Childhood Education, or possess a Bachelor's Degree in another field but have also obtained an Associate's Degree in ECE, a Technical College Diploma or Certificate in ECE, a Montessori Teaching Diploma accredited by MACTE, or a valid Preschool CDA credential, and are able to pass a background check.
